Editing a Work Group

You can edit a work group in the Administration section of HotDocs Advance.

You must have Site Administrator or Content Administrator role to edit a work group.

To edit a work group

By default the Templates and Access Permissions lists show only the selected items. Deselect Show selected only to show all available items.

  1. In the Administration section, click Manage Work GroupsManage work groups
  2. From the list of work groups, select the work group you wish to edit.
  3. In the Details pane, click ResumeEdit.
  4. You can edit the following work group details:
    • Name (required) — the work group's name.
    • Description (optional) — a description of the work group.
    • Active/Inactive — toggle the Active status of the work group; inactive work groups cannot be accessed by users
    • All Templates status — toggle the templates used by the work group. Either:
      • Work group contains all templates (default) – all templates uploaded to the Advance site are included in the work group
      • Work group contains selected templates – only the templates selected in the Templates tab are included in the work group 
    • Templates (optional) — select templates to add to the work group.
    • Access permissions (optional) — select the user groups that can access the work group. Users in the selected user groups can assemble the templates selected above.
    • Workflows — toggle the work group's use of approval workflows on work items. Either:
      • Work items don't use a workflow (default) – work items in the work group do not use workflows
      • Work items use a workflow – work items in the work group do use workflows
  5. Click Save Changes.

The details of the work group are now updated.
